MEMORANDUM OPINION

GESELL, District Judge.

This action, seeking compensatory and punitive damages for various alleged breaches of fiduciary and contractual duty, is brought by eight trustees on behalf of themselves and the two employee benefit plans1 for which they act as named fiduciaries.
